The Unrivaled Power of the .338 Lapua Magnum
The .338 Lapua Magnum is renowned globally as one of the preeminent cartridges for extreme long-range shooting and hunting formidable game. Designed for military sniper applications, its inherent accuracy potential and massive energy delivery at extended ranges have made it a favorite among civilian marksmen and hunters alike. It excels where other cartridges falter, offering superior ballistic performance beyond 800, 1000, or even 1500 yards. This cartridge provides the raw power needed to anchor large animals or consistently impact distant steel targets. However, the true potential of the .338 Lapua Magnum can only be unlocked with ammunition specifically designed to leverage its capabilities.

The Heart of the Performance: Nosler 300 Grain AccuBond Bullet
The cornerstone of this exceptional ammunition is the 300 grain AccuBond bullet. Developed by Nosler, the AccuBond is a bonded-core bullet specifically engineered to deliver reliable, controlled expansion and deep penetration across a wide range of velocities, making it ideal for large and dangerous game.
Let's delve into the innovative design features of the AccuBond bullet that contribute to its outstanding performance:
- Proprietary Bonding Process: Unlike conventional cup-and-core bullets where the jacket and core can separate, the AccuBond features a lead alloy core that is chemically bonded to a gilding metal jacket. This robust bond ensures that the bullet retains virtually all of its weight (often over 90%) upon impact, driving deeper into the target to reach vital organs, even after encountering heavy bone.
- Polymer Tip: The streamlined polymer tip initiates expansion reliably upon impact, even at lower velocities experienced at extreme ranges. It also helps to resist deformation in the magazine, preserving the bullet's ballistic integrity.
- Tapered Jacket: The jacket is strategically tapered, thinner at the nose for rapid initial expansion and progressively thicker towards the base to control expansion and facilitate deep penetration.
- Boat-Tail Design: A boat-tail base reduces drag, improving the bullet's ballistic coefficient (BC). A higher BC means the bullet flies flatter, resists wind drift more effectively, and retains more energy downrange, which is crucial for extreme long-range shots.
- Consistently Uniform J&J (Jacket and Core): Nosler's manufacturing process ensures that the bullet's jacket and core are consistently uniform, leading to superior rotational stability and ultimately, exceptional accuracy.

Ballistic Characteristics and Trust-Building Data
While specific external ballistic data can vary slightly based on barrel length, atmospheric conditions, and individual rifle characteristics, the Nosler Trophy Grade .338 Lapua Magnum 300 grain AccuBond consistently demonstrates impressive figures.
- High Ballistic Coefficient (BC): The 300 grain AccuBond bullet typically boasts a G1 Ballistic Coefficient in the range of .625 - .645 (and a G7 BC around .315 - .330), making it exceptionally aerodynamic. This high BC means it sheds velocity more slowly and is less affected by crosswinds, leading to a flatter trajectory and less wind drift at extended distances.
- Muzzle Velocity: From a standard 26-inch test barrel, muzzle velocities often hover around 2,500 feet per second (fps), generating immense muzzle energy. This powerful start ensures that the bullet carries substantial energy far downrange, maintaining its terminal performance capabilities.
- Downrange Energy: At 500 yards, the 300 grain AccuBond will still retain over 3,000 foot-pounds of energy, which is more than sufficient for effective expansion and penetration on even the largest game. At 1000 yards, it can still deliver over 1,500 foot-pounds, underscoring its extreme long-range effectiveness.

Tips for Maximizing Performance with .338 Lapua Magnum
To truly unlock the potential of your .338 Lapua Magnum and Nosler Trophy Grade ammunition, consider these expert tips:
- Quality Optics: Invest in a high-quality scope with reliable adjustments, clear glass, and a suitable reticle for long-range shooting. First focal plane (FFP) scopes are often preferred for varying magnifications with consistent reticle subtensions.
- Stable Shooting Platform: Whether prone with a bipod, using shooting sticks, or a bench rest, a stable platform is non-negotiable for extreme long-range accuracy.
- Understand Ballistics: Familiarize yourself with external ballistics. Use a ballistic calculator (many are available as apps) to generate accurate drop and windage solutions for your specific rifle, ammunition, and environmental conditions.
- Practice Wind Reading: Wind is the greatest variable in long-range shooting. Learning to read wind flags, mirage, and environmental cues is a critical skill.
- Master Fundamentals: Consistent trigger control, proper breathing, and a solid natural point of aim are foundational. Even the best ammunition cannot compensate for poor shooting habits.
- Rifle Maintenance: Keep your rifle clean and well-maintained. A fouled barrel can negatively impact accuracy.
